电脑唱歌软件背后的黑科技:从语音合成到虚拟歌姬239


电脑唱歌软件,如今已经不再是遥不可及的黑科技,而是走进了寻常百姓家。无论是专业的音乐制作人,还是业余的音乐爱好者,都能通过这些软件轻松地创作出歌曲,甚至虚拟出拥有独特音色的虚拟歌姬。但你是否想过,这些软件究竟是如何实现的呢?它们背后究竟隐藏着哪些令人惊叹的技术?本文将带你深入了解电脑唱歌软件的技术原理,揭开其神秘的面纱。

电脑唱歌软件的核心技术,可以概括为三个方面:语音合成(Speech Synthesis)、音高修正(Pitch Correction)和声学模型(Acoustic Modeling)。这三者相互配合,最终实现了将人类演唱的声音转化为数字信号,并进行编辑、处理和合成,最终生成歌曲的效果。

首先,我们来看看语音合成技术。这是电脑唱歌软件的基础,它负责将文本信息转化为语音。早期的语音合成技术比较粗糙,生成的语音听起来机械僵硬,缺乏情感和自然度。而现代的语音合成技术则采用了更先进的算法,例如连接式语音合成(Concatenative Synthesis)和参数化语音合成(Parametric Synthesis)。连接式语音合成通过拼接预先录制的大量语音片段来生成新的语音,其优点是语音质量较高,但缺点是需要大量的语音数据,且拼接后的语音可能不够流畅自然。参数化语音合成则通过对语音的声学参数进行建模,然后根据模型生成语音,其优点是可以生成任意长度和内容的语音,且语音更加流畅自然,但缺点是模型的训练较为复杂,需要大量的计算资源。

近年来,深度学习技术在语音合成领域取得了突破性的进展。基于深度神经网络的语音合成技术,例如WaveNet和Tacotron,可以生成高质量、自然流畅的语音,甚至可以模仿不同人的声音。这些技术的应用,使得电脑唱歌软件生成的语音更加逼真,情感表达也更加丰富。

其次,音高修正技术是电脑唱歌软件的另一个重要组成部分。由于人类演唱时音高难免会有一些偏差,音高修正技术可以自动检测并修正演唱者音高的偏差,使演唱更加精准。常用的音高修正算法包括自动调音(Auto-Tune)和音调转换(Pitch Shifting)。自动调音算法可以将演唱者的音高修正到预设的音高上,而音调转换算法则可以改变演唱的音调,例如提高或降低音调。

然而,单纯的音高修正容易导致演唱失去自然感,因此,现代的电脑唱歌软件通常会结合音高修正和声学模型来实现更自然的效果。例如,一些软件会根据演唱者的演唱风格和情感,智能地调整音高修正的强度,避免过度修正导致的生硬感。 优秀的音高修正技术需要考虑音符的持续时间、音高变化速度等因素,力求在修正音准的同时保持演唱的自然流畅。

最后,声学模型在电脑唱歌软件中扮演着至关重要的角色。它负责模拟乐器的音色、混响等声学效果,并对生成的语音进行处理,使其听起来更加饱满、立体。一个好的声学模型可以赋予虚拟歌姬独特的音色和演唱风格。 先进的声学模型通常会基于大量的音频数据进行训练,并运用复杂的算法来模拟各种声学现象。例如,它可以模拟不同麦克风的录音效果,或者模拟不同房间的混响效果,从而提高歌曲的整体音质。

除了上述核心技术之外,一些电脑唱歌软件还集成了其他功能,例如节奏检测、和声生成、伴奏生成等等。这些功能可以进一步提高音乐创作的效率,并使音乐创作更加便捷。例如,节奏检测可以自动检测音乐的节奏,并根据节奏自动生成伴奏;和声生成可以根据主旋律自动生成和声;伴奏生成则可以根据歌曲风格自动生成伴奏。

总而言之,电脑唱歌软件的发展离不开语音合成、音高修正和声学模型等核心技术的进步。随着人工智能技术的不断发展,电脑唱歌软件的功能会越来越强大,生成的音乐也会越来越逼真、自然。未来,电脑唱歌软件或许能实现真正的“AI作曲”,为音乐创作带来无限可能。 我们也有理由期待,未来的电脑唱歌软件能够更精准地捕捉人类的情感,并将其转化为音乐,创作出更具艺术感染力的作品。

2025-06-09


上一篇:电脑全院满座剪辑软件推荐及使用技巧

下一篇:电脑上找不到软件?可能是这些原因!详细排查指南